Data Analyst - Retrofit

Permanent


Your role:

The GMCA has an exciting opportunity for a Data Analyst (Retrofit) to join its award-winning Retrofit Team in the Environment Directorate.

The role will provide Business Intelligence support to a team delivering over £100m of housing retrofit measures to help meet the targets in the Greater Manchester 5-year Environment Plan and Retrofit Action Plan which are aiming to make Greater Manchester carbon neutral by 2038.

A key focus of the role will be to provide accurate and consistent reporting of data relating to housing retrofit schemes delivered to residents of Greater Manchester by leading and supporting the development and maintenance of appropriate management information systems for the Retrofit Team, including in-house systems.

The energy efficiency improvements and low carbon heating systems installed through these schemes will result in homes that are cheaper to heat, more comfortable to live in, and have less impact on the environment.


About you:

The GMCA is seeking an individual with experience of working with data in a public sector or housing provider environment with an in depth understanding of how large amounts of retrofit data are collected, quality checked, cleansed, validated, analysed, and presented accurately by set deadlines.

A commitment to partnership working is essential, as you will work closely with government departments, local authorities, registered providers of social housing, the NHS, contractors, and a wide range of local partners. Most importantly, we are looking for an individual with a passion for tackling climate change and fuel poverty, as this retrofit-focussed role is an excellent opportunity to have a direct impact on these issues.

The role requires significant knowledge of IT systems for data analysis and presentation. Therefore, the post is ideal for an individual with considerable experience of using Excel, Tableau, Power BI; or SQL at an advanced level.

The role will also involve supporting the management of the national Net Zero Housing Retrofit Framework Agreement, including the administration of the Framework Agreement, call-offs, and mini competitions. Therefore, knowledge of public sector procurement principles and previous experience with public procurement processes would be beneficial.

Hybrid working

This role is part of GMCA’s hybrid working scheme. As part of our commitment to ‘Build Back Fairer’ in Greater Manchester following the Covid-19 pandemic, we have evolved our management methods by trusting and empowering staff to deliver their work in the best way that suits the business and their individual needs, and supports health and wellbeing. Our hybrid working policy sets out a flexible approach, combining attendance at our Manchester city centre office with remote working, typically from home; the location of work is primarily dictated by the needs of the business: ‘Do what is right for you and the business on that day’. If appointed to the role you will work with your manager to agree and regularly review the best working pattern for you, your team and your work.
